Farming and Ranching

Students around the country participate in farming and ranching activities. Some 4-Hers raise animals to show at regional fairs. Some have honey bee hives that produce honey to sell at local farmers' markets. Many Falcon 4-H students are already working on family farms that may make them eligible to show their products at the Tennessee State Fair. Click here for more info.
